The Nkashi Trust is a Botswana-based non-governmental organization dedicated to preserving the unique cultural heritage of mokoro poling within the Okavango Delta. Established to safeguard the traditional art of propelling a mokoro canoe, the Trust actively supports the community of indigenous polers. Through various initiatives, it works to ensure the sustainability of this vital skill, which is central to both the local economy and tourism in the region. The organisation also promotes responsible and culturally sensitive tourism practices, benefiting both visitors and local communities in Botswana’s iconic wetland. By empowering polers and documenting their rich history, The Nkashi Trust plays a crucial role in safeguarding an important part of Botswana’s intangible cultural legacy.
